Cobra TrafficCobra WeatherCobra Local RoadsCobra Petrol StationsCobra HotelsCobra RestaurantsCobra Car RepairCobra more services
Cobra City Info
2025-07-10
Roadnow
Let's chat about Cobra
2025-07-10
Guest
